Step 1: Define Your Campaign Goal
The first step in starting a fundraiser is to set clear and specific goals. Determine how much money you need to raise and for what purpose. This clarity is crucial because it allows your potential donors to understand the impact of their contributions. Your fundraising efforts will be more effective if your goals are well-defined and based on a detailed cost breakdown.

Step 3: Tell Your Story
A compelling story can make or break a fundraiser. It's important to communicate the purpose of your fundraising efforts, the specific need, and how the funds will be used. This emotional connection is crucial for engaging potential donors. Here are some pointers to help you craft a perfect fundraiser story:
What will the funds be used for? How are you connected to the cause? How will the donations raised aid you or help others? Why does the recipient need this donation?Be sure to answer these questions in a clear and compelling manner. This will help your donors understand and connect with your cause, leading to more donations.
Step 4: Spread the Word
Once your fundraiser is set up, it's time to promote it. Share your campaign with trusted friends and family, and use their feedback to refine your story. Adding powerful images and videos can enhance your campaign's appeal. Ask your inner circle to make a donation, and once you have some initial support, share it widely on social media, email, and other networks.
People are more likely to donate if they see that others have already contributed. This social proof can motivate others to join in. After sharing with your network, continue to use various methods to spread the word. The wider your reach, the more impact your fundraiser can have.
